汉字拆解
迷糊 (muddled / absent-minded) + 蛋 (person suffix) -> scatterbrained person.
含义
A scatterbrained or absent-minded person. It is usually mild and teasing rather than harsh.
迷糊蛋 describes someone who forgets details, gets confused, or moves through life a bit dazed. It can be affectionate if used gently, but avoid using it to dismiss real difficulties.
例句
- 他又坐错车,真是个迷糊蛋。
- 迷糊蛋出门前最好列清单。
- 她只是太累了,别老叫人迷糊蛋。

起源与历史
From 迷糊, confused or dazed, plus 蛋, a person-like suffix.
文化背景
时代: Modern colloquial Mandarin
世代: Broadly understood
社会背景: Common in family and friend speech
地区说明: Used across Mainland China, less trendy than newer slang.
